Croatia holiday 'offers tourists diverse experience'
19 April 2010Tourists who opt to head to Croatia this year will be met with a different and diverse country, according to a travel expert.
Meri Matesic, director at the Croatian National Tourist Office in London, says the range of activities on offer in the coastal country within a short distance makes it an interesting place to visit.
"In one day, within a few hours you can sail down, dive, go on the beach and in the next hour you can do mountain walking, biking, hiking, or whatever you want to do," she notes.
It is perhaps the country's special landscape that produces such a plethora of opportunities.
With an abundance of attractive beaches lining its Adriatic coastline, sunbathing and relaxing on the sand is widely available.
But just a few miles inland lies diverse countryside and mountain ranges, offering the chance for walking and mountain climbing.
If history is on the agenda, then families and couples should perhaps head to Dubrovnik, where the city's walls date back to the 12th century.
